Transaction 761f7e50b0b7b352895d8687eefd1013136f1a54573c9f2aa5a5e75dfb439f90

3 Input
2 Outputs
  • 761f7e50b0b7b352895d8687eefd1013136f1a54573c9f2aa5a5e75dfb439f90:0
  • value  2100000000
    address  3Q3y14M1177ebrKfD9Z3MPCkr4Jy7CdwXp
  • 761f7e50b0b7b352895d8687eefd1013136f1a54573c9f2aa5a5e75dfb439f90:1
  • value  3239256437
    address  3Dz9h499aWX494AifYMBESCCwXnudfxsKo